Limited stock, only 1 bottle left. The colour is an intense brooding blackness with touches of violet at the rim. The nose is an opulence of classical Barossa Cabernet blackcurrants & violets. A great generosity of flavour & velvet fruit reined in by the fine chalky tannins on the finish. The 2004 vintage is held in high regard in the Barossa, giving red & white wines of excellent regional & varietal character. Premium Cabernet Sauvignon vineyards in Light Pass & Tanunda districts of the Barossa Valley. Fermented & macerated on skins for up to 2 weeks with some partial barrel fermentation. Following pressing & clarification, the wine was matured in French oak hogsheads for Approx. 18 months. Mentor is an ideal accompaniment for rich duck, goose & game dishes. It is superb with oxtail, braised lamb shanks & wonderful with a fine aged cheddar. Grape: 63% Cabernet Sauvignon, 21% Merlot & 16% Shiraz. ...

The colour is deep red-black leading to a bouquet showing hints of chocolate & dark plums. These flavours extend to the palate which is richly structured with a fine, persistent finish
- a wine of great style & power. The 2006 vintage is highly rated by the winemakers & has produced wines of great depth, flavour & richness. Extremely low yielding mature vineyards in the Barossa Valley districts of Kabiningie, Dorrien, Freeling & Greenock. Fermented & macerated on skins for up to 2 weeks with some partial barrel fermentation. After pressing & clarification, matured in 90% French & 10% American oak hogsheads for approx 18 months. Savour with rich game dishes, roast beef, & hard cheese such as Parmigiano Reggiano, aged cheddar or Grana Padana. Stonewell Shiraz is Peter Lehmann Wines best wine of each vintage & one of the worlds great Shiraz. It is the most powerful expression of Shiraz we make from our growers vineyards. The pedigree of these vineyards & the knowledge that has been passed from each winemaking generation at Peter Lehmann Wines to the next, assures us these will be wines of great longevity. The story of Stonewell Shiraz began in 1987 when Peter Lehmann decided to make a special Shiraz
- a wine of immense intensity & muscularity that would demand time in the barrel & bottle before release. The wine was named Stonewell after the district that he believed best showed the characters admired most in Barossa Shiraz. This tradition has continued & each vintage the best Shiraz from our legacy of growers Barossa vineyards is chosen to create Stonewell. Usually no more than a dozen small, old vineyards are selected each year, the oldest planted in 1885. Located in the harder country, these are some of our lowest yielding vineyards. The berries are small & sparse with crops typically less than 2 tonnes per acre.
